Hello I am new. Are there some things that I should know? And, how do you run an ask blog like this?

oh gosh wELL! I guess. I can try and bestow some wisdom I’ve gotten over the years for askblogging 

first off, if your looking to start a blog, find a usable theme you like, make sure it’s accessible. this is /really hard/ because tumblr can be awful most times but accessibility is the key. if people can’t find the ask page they can’t send you asks and then your straight up dead in the water. 

figure out what kind of story you want to tell, if any. no plot blogs are fine too, but since I run a plot based blog that’s what you get out of me, I love plot, keeps me engaged.but on the note of that, don’t plan every little thing out before you start. the more you can make up along the way, the more fun you’ll have working on it and motivation is a serious challenge when making a successful story that last. I found that just having a skeleton structure of a story and then filling in the details as I go is the best method for me, so that’s what I recommend! your skills at story telling will get better as you go with this sort of stuff and not planning everything out too throughly allows you to retcon when needed without uprooting large parts of plot.On that note, try not to make a new blog with every new idea you get, because none of them will get anywhere in the end. incorporating those ideas into your current blog is a good way around this but not foolproof. I’m also a bit hypocritical on this but I’m trying really hard to finish this blog, even if it takes me ages

keep in mind the main characters are going to be drawn a TON. make their designs something you can easily draw repeatedly. I wouldn’t recommend something complicated because you’ll get very tired of drawing all those details very quickly.Vu can be considered a fairly complicated design but I dug that grave for myself and thus I lie in it. (if you find a technique that cuts down on art time for a char then that’s honestly great. and is what I ended up doing with vu!)

Asks can be hard to get sometimes depending on the people active at the time, so keep in mind that there will be dry spells. ask calls are great for getting around this and also get that sweet interaction options but anon is your friend and try to keep that on for the most part, unless it becomes a problem. it has never been one for me, but I know some people who had to turn it off because the questions they got were nasty.Basically what I do is horde EVERY SINGLE ASK I GET that is useful and then pick them up when I get to a point where I can use them. it’s done me good so far, even if I use an ask 3 years later whoops.

the community is important, and so is interacting with them! characters asking things is the easiest way for something like that to go about, and leads to interesting stuff. it’s always good to be respectful of other people’s characters however, so if your unsure if something would be ok, just ask them about it! people are generally willing to talk things over with you I’ve found.

collabing (co running a blog) is a great thing and I recommend it but if you decide to work with someone else be sure it’s someone who you can talk to openly! my entire mon universe is p much a giant collab with my best friend and I love it, but I’ve seen blogs fall to pieces when people in the collab get into fights and fall apart. so there’s ups and downs to both sides.

I think that’s.. well that’s all I can think of. good luck and lemme know if you end up blogging!
